    RATING SCALE
    (Discuss potential changes in this thread)

    All Americans: 68-74
    Top (Impact) Players: 66-71 (Probably only a few players on each team)
    FBS Transfers: 70-74
    FCS Transfers:66-70
    Starters: 60-67
    2nd String: 56-60(Guys that are in the rotation)
    Bench:50-55 (Non-factors, special teamers, and guys that only play a few plays a game.)
    Fresh: MAX at 52


    D3/NAIA SCHOOLS SUBTRACT 3 POINTS

    If these guidelines are not followed your team will not be posted.

    Recruiting Pitches

    Program Prestige: ALL Schools should be 1 star with the exception of maybe a few teams at 2 stars such as Minnesota Duluth, Northwest Missouri State, Delta State, Valdosta State, Grand Valley, and North Alabama.

    Academic Prestige: This could vary a lot, so thats upto you!

    Campus Lifestyle: Another one thats upto you. Party School. Christian School. Whatever it is... Probably capped at C+
    Coach Experience: Give a bonus of one grade if the Coach has experience as an FBS Head Coach/NFL coaching experience; or a full letter grade for exp as an NFL HC,
    No exp: D
    Less than 2 years exp: D+
    3 years: C
    5 years: C+
    7 years: B
    10 years exp: B+

    Coach Prestige: If the coach has been part of a successful team, as a player or coach they should be highly ranked. Also if they had respectable careers as players adjust accordingly.

    Championship Contender: The teams that had a 2 star Program Prestige should also have a C rating here.. Everyone else at a lower grade with most falling at a D.

    Athletic Facilities: Should be no higher than C with 95% of schools falling in the D/D+ range.

    Pro Potential: This will factor in current NFL players, past NFL players, and the level of their success. (Non-NFL players may have a small impact: UFL, AFL, AFL2, CFL, etc.) Cap at C.

    Program Stability: Capped at B and that should only be given to schools with a streak of winning seasons longer than 5 years. Programs with head coaching changes should see a penalty.

    Program Tradition: Capped at B, and should be given to schools with a repuation of winning, putting out quality players, have a name that college football fans know. (B Teams will include the same as 2 Star Program Prestige teams.)

    Fan Base: Almost all teams will be at D rating.. capped at C+.
